#63a9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63a9ae is composed of 38.8% red, 66.3%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 184 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 53.5%. #63a9ae color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00535d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#63a9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63a9ae has RGB values of R:99, G:169,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 6531502.

Shades and Tints of #63a9ae
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#63a9ae
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#87898a is the less saturated color, while #1ae8f7 is the most saturated one.
